Ripple to Overhaul XRP Staking for DeFi Expansion

Ripple is considering a major revamp of XRP staking to bolster its role in DeFi, propelled by regulatory clarity and increased institutional engagement in 2025.

This change could significantly redefine XRP's market position, intensifying competition with other DeFi assets and potentially impacting industry-wide adoption trends.

Ripple explores a major XRP staking overhaul to enhance its DeFi role following regulatory clarity and institutional interest.

Ripple is actively exploring a major overhaul of XRP staking to enhance its role in decentralized finance. Driven by regulatory clarity and institutional interest, Ripple aims to integrate innovative staking solutions.

XRP Ledger's Staking Enhancement Under Ripple's Leadership

Led by CEO Brad Garlinghouse and CTO David Schwartz, Ripple plans to expand staking features on the XRP Ledger. The initiative aims to bring real DeFi utility to XRP, with increased emphasis on yield products.

Partnerships with Mastercard and WebBank Propel XRP

Post-SEC ruling, Ripple's institutional engagements, including over $500 million in funding, bolster XRP's market position. Partnerships with Mastercard and WebBank facilitate a multibillion-dollar DeFi push for XRP.
